    Particle Creation by a Moving Boundary with Robin Boundary Condition

    Full text link
    We consider a massless scalar field in 1+1 dimensions satisfying a Robin boundary condition (BC) at a non-relativistic moving boundary. We derive a Bogoliubov transformation between input and output bosonic field operators, which allows us to calculate the spectral distribution of created particles. The cases of Dirichlet and Neumann BC may be obtained from our result as limiting cases. These two limits yield the same spectrum, which turns out to be an upper bound for the spectra derived for Robin BC. We show that the particle emission effect can be considerably reduced (with respect to the Dirichlet/Neumann case) by selecting a particular value for the oscillation frequency of the boundary position

    Geração de mapas georreferenciados para visualização de dados de campo para auxílio na tomada de decisão em irrigação de precisão.

    Get PDF
    Este trabalho teve como objetivo desenvolver um aplicativo computacional capaz de gerar mapas georreferenciados úteis para a tomada de decisão em irrigação de precisão. Para tanto, foram utilizadas as bibliotecas TerraLib e SOMCode, ambas de código aberto e escritas na linguagem C++, desenvolvidas pelo Instituto Nacional de Pesquisas Espaciais (INPE) e pela Embrapa Tabuleiros Costeiros (CPATC), respectivamente. Os dados utilizados para a geração desses mapas foram obtidos por uma grade de sensores de uma unidade piloto da plataforma Irrigap, desenvolvida pela Embrapa Instrumentação Agropecuária (CNPDIA), dados esses referentes a medidas horárias de umidade e temperatura do solo e temperatura do ar. Diferentes métodos de interpolação foram utilizados, com o intuito de verificar qual a melhor maneira de se gerar mapas que possibilitem a visualização de áreas com o mesmo comportamento com relação às variáveis de solo e climatológicas, as chamadas zonas de manejo agrícolas. Os resultados obtidos mostraram que é possível a identificação dessas zonas, desde que sejam utilizados os algoritmos corretos para cada situação. Além disso, aplicativos para a geração de mapas temáticos utilizando dados reais podem se tornar importantes para a tomada de decisão em agricultura de precisão, proporcionando benefícios como a economia de água e energia durante o período de irrigação

    The lateral Casimir force beyond the proximity force approximation: a nontrivial interplay between geometry and quantum vacuum

    Get PDF
    The lateral Casimir force between two corrugated metallic plates makes possible a study of the nontrivial interplay of geometry and Casimir effect appearing beyond the regime of validity of the Proximity Force Approximation (PFA). Quantitative evaluations can be obtained by using scattering theory in a perturbative expansion valid when the corrugation amplitudes are smaller than the three other length scales: the mean separation distance LL of the plates, the corrugation period \lambda_\C and the plasma wavelength λ\lambda_\P. Within this perturbative expansion, evaluations are obtained for arbitrary relative values of LL, \lambda_\C and λ\lambda_\P while limiting cases, some of them already known, are recovered when these values obey some specific orderings. The consequence of these results for comparison with existing experiments is discussed in the end of the paper

    Hamiltonian symplectic embedding of the massive noncommutative U(1) Theory

    Full text link
    We show that the massive noncommutative U(1) theory is embedded in a gauge theory using an alternative systematic way, which is based on the symplectic framework. The embedded Hamiltonian density is obtained after a finite number of steps in the iterative symplectic process, oppositely to the result proposed using the BFFT formalism.     Lateral Casimir force beyond the Proximity Force Approximation

    Full text link
    We argue that the appropriate variable to study a non trivial geometry dependence of the Casimir force is the lateral component of the Casimir force, which we evaluate between two corrugated metallic plates outside the validity of the Proximity Force Approximation (PFA). The metallic plates are described by the plasma model, with arbitrary values for the plasma wavelength, the plate separation and the corrugation period, the corrugation amplitude remaining the smallest length scale. Our analysis shows that in realistic experimental situations the Proximity Force Approximation overestimates the force by up to 30%.Comment: 4 pages.
